The 6th Singapore Division (6 DIV) is a combined arms division of the Singapore Army. [2]

History

The 6th Division was formed on 1 October 1976 as a reserve division to manage and train reservist units. [3] [4] In November 1976, HQ 6th Singapore Infantry Brigade, was formed under the 6th Division's command. [2]

In November 1992, the 6th Division became a combined arms division as part of the reorganisation within the Singapore Armed Forces (SAF), having at least one Infantry brigade and one Armour brigade, among others. [3] [4] In the 2000s, the HQ 6th Division relocated to Mandai Hill Camp. In November 2020, HQ Army Intelligence and HQ Artillery came under the command of the 6th Division. [2]
